What is the magnetic moment for Mn²⁺ ion in low spin state

Options

(a) 5.90 BM
(b) 8.90 BM
(c) 2.8 BM
(d) 1.73 BM

Correct Answer:

1.73 BM

Explanation:

For Mn²⁺ ion in low spin state, number of unpaired electrons = 1. Magnetic moment = √n(n+2) =√1*3=1.73 BM.
